Output 2673f598784e30b8206781c496d6b6673f3a0eb72c5b2fdf1caf152a1ba0e18c:10

value
1983264477
script pubkey
OP_0 OP_PUSHBYTES_20 15d22324c09598554c6bc11069dfe6f88e572284
address
bc1qzhfzxfxqjkv92nrtcygxnhlxlz89wg5yfyqrk2
transaction
2673f598784e30b8206781c496d6b6673f3a0eb72c5b2fdf1caf152a1ba0e18c
spent
true